Handover note — Crumbwheel order cutoffs.

Welcome aboard. The bakery cutoff rule in Crumbwheel closes same-day orders at 14:00 local to each storefront, not UTC — this has bitten us twice. Holiday overrides live in the calendar service and take precedence silently, so always check there first when a cutoff looks wrong. To unlock the calendar service's admin console after a restart, enter the recovery passphrase below.

vault phrase of bagap-bahaf = silion-pelox-sorox-casdor-quenwyn-fraax-eliox-praael-kelion-quenvan-kasox-rusael-norius-belvan

Handover: Exportron retry queue

Hi Mira — handing over the failed-export retries. Exports that hit a timeout land in the retry queue and get three attempts with backoff; after that they're parked and need a manual requeue from the admin panel. Watch for customers reporting duplicates — that usually means a double requeue. The current retry settings are as follows.

settings of bajog-fawig:
oliael:
  log_level: warn
  metrics_host: metrics.oliael.zemvarsys.internal
  pin: 0267
  pool_size: 32

### Step 4 — Re-enable bulk edits in the Ledgerpane admin table

After the schema migration completes, bulk edits must be switched back on carefully. The new batching layer writes in chunks of 200 rows and holds a row-level lock per chunk, so re-enable during a quiet window and watch the lock-wait dashboard for five minutes. If waits exceed one second, halt and roll back to step 3. Apply the following configuration values to the admin service.

config for kajog-tadug:
[casax]
port = 11211
region = west-3
host = casax.nelvroworks.internal
timeout_ms = 5000
retries = 7